Twenty years ago, a distinctive voice from Kingston, Jamaica, redefined the sound of global pop. Sean Paul’s sophomore album, Dutty Rock , didn't just climb the charts; it brought the raw, pulsating energy of dancehall into the mainstream with an impact that still resonates today.
